Recap for Assembly Meeting - January 28, 2025

Writer's picture: csg frontofficecsg frontoffice

Central Student Government's Assembly met on Tuesday, January 28st at 7:30 p.m. EDT in the Wolverine room of the Union. You can find the recap here.
